Ken Gachowski Virgil Beyer Orville Olson Thomas Harris Ron Wood Charlotte Fields Jerry Morrison Patrick Morrison Harold Finney Roy Chock Hyacinth Finney Donald Beach Bob Johnson 3017 County Road H -2 2742 County Road J 8101 Edgewood Drive 8310 Eastwood Drive 6960 Silver Lake Road 2255 Lambert 5309 Jackson Drive 5262 Skiba Drive 7624 Spring Lake Road 7511 Greenfield Avenue 7624 Spring Lake Road 2265 Oakwood Drive 2259 Oakwood Drive Their comments are as follows: Harold Finney, 7624 Spring Lake Road, stated that he has a truck parked in his yard and that he is receiving tickets every day on his trucks. He stated that he feels that he is not hurting anyone by parking his truck there. Bob Schmitt, 8110 Edgewood Drive, stated that he concurred with Mr. Finney that he also should be able to park his truck in his yard. He stated that he feels that it's against a persons right not to be able to park their truck in their yard when the truck is used to make his living. He further stated that he has had no complaints from his neighbors. Ron Wood, 6960 Silver Lake Road, stated that he also has a truck in his yard. He stated that he pays his taxes and feels that there is no reason why he can't keep his truck there. Roy Chock, 7511 Greenfield Avenue, stated that he works part -time for Mr. Finney, and further that Mr. Finney parks his truck in his yard because of vandals. Patrick Morrison, 5262 Skiba Drive, stated that he does not feel that there is anything wrong with parking your truck in your yard. Thomas Harris, 8310 Eastwood Drive, stated that he parks his truck in his yard after the road restrictions are off. Further that he has a 1 ton and 2 1/2 ton truck. He further stated that last Wednesday he received a ticket on the 1 ton truck. He further stated that he has received no complaints from his neighbors regarding the parking of his truck.
